Handover: Deploybeak bot (the chat bot that posts deploy status to the Mosswick channels). It's stable; main gotcha is the webhook occasionally stalls after a platform restart — just restart the listener pod. Don't touch the message templates without checking with the release team; formatting breaks their parser. Pending work: add canary status to the summary line. Runbook, architecture notes, and open tasks are all here:

runbook for kawef-hahif: https://jira.lumicsys.internal/projects/browse/display/c08d703c

Notes from Tuesday ops meeting — payslips for the Redlow yard. As the Redlow site still has no working printer, payroll confirmed that paper payslips will be printed centrally at the Hartvale office and delivered in sealed envelopes each month. Envelopes are to be sorted by surname and bundled per shift before dispatch. The site lead will sign for the bundle and distribute the same day; nothing is to be left unattended in the portacabin. The specific courier hand-over instruction appears below.

dispatch memo: the lamwyn fenwyn courier leaves the wenir ledger at gate 7175 under passcode 822969

Hey Marit — handing off the Pondrel websocket reconnect bug before my leave. Short version: clients retried with no backoff after auth token expiry, hammering the edge tier. Fix adds capped jitter plus token refresh before reconnect. Please eyeball the auth path for replay risk. The relevant settings now read as follows.

settings of fafog-haduf:
ZORIX_PIN=4648
ZORIX_METRICS_HOST=metrics.zorix.paliqsys.corp
ZORIX_LOG_LEVEL=info
ZORIX_TENANT=druix